Acerca de esta escucha
It's Holy Week in the small town of Las Penas, New Mexico, and 33-year-old unemployed Amadeo Padilla has been given the part of Jesus in the Good Friday procession. He is preparing feverishly for this role when his 15-year-old daughter, Angel, shows up pregnant on his doorstep and disrupts his plans for personal redemption. With weeks to go until her due date, tough, ebullient Angel has fled her mother's house, setting her life on a startling new path.
Vivid, tender, funny, and beautifully rendered, The Five Wounds spans the baby's first year as five generations of the Padilla family converge: Amadeo's mother, Yolanda, reeling from a recent discovery; Angel's mother, Marissa, whom Angel isn't speaking to; and disapproving Tive, Yolanda's uncle and keeper of the family's history. Each brings expectations that Amadeo doesn't think he can live up to.
The Five Wounds is a miraculous debut novel from a writer whose stories have been hailed as "legitimate masterpieces" (New York Times). Kirstin Valdez Quade conjures characters that will linger long after the book's conclusion, bringing to life their struggles to parent children they may not be equipped to save.

The Inner Dialogues Bring Depth to the Human Condi
Valdez Quade's skill at developing characters through not only their actions, but their thought filled reactions, as well as those around them says so much about the human condition and what is not said in our relationships. The author communicates such a strong, sense of place and culture. I was in the small New Mexico town with the characters and while their circumstances could not be more differen than mine, their challenges, their values, their joy in family are universal. We make so many choices in life, yet the big choices we make are what we choose to think about them. We see and hopefully understand the roots of how we come to thinking in such different ways about an event, such as a teenage pregnancy.
The thoughtful reader will look beyong this wonderful narrative and think about their own choices, reactions and thoughts. I know I do.
